Caracalla, (A.D. 198-217), silver denarius, issued 213-217, Rome mint, (3.64 g), obv. laureate head to right of Caracalla, around ANTONINVS PIVS AVG GERM, rev. Liberalitas standing half-left, holding abacus and cornucopiae, around LIBERAL AVG VIIII , (S.6814, RIC 302, RSC 139) (illustrated); another, (3.10 g), rev. Virtus standing right with foot on helmet, holding spear, (S.6869, RIC 112, RSC 464); another, (3.02 g), rev. Salus seated to left, holding a cornucopiae with a snake coiled around an altar feeding from a patera, around P M TR P VIII COS II PP, (S.6860, RIC 82, RSC 422). Toning, nearly very fine - good very fine. (3)
Ex Dr V.J.A. Flynn Collection.
